President Obama cannot do it alone. The best way to save on incarceration costs is prevention. Prevention is the most effective way to keep the jail population from growing. According to the Bureau of Justice, at midyear 2008, there were 4,777 black male inmates per 100,000 U.S. residents being held in state or federal prison and local jails.Providing jobs, job training, dental care, clothing and food is a start, but more needs to be done to keep people from re-entering the jail system.
